What It Is

iCueMotion positions itself as a “skill augmentation” R&D lab focused on human movement performance and learning. It is not a conventional fitness-tracking tool; instead, it aims to combine motion measurement, feedback mechanisms, and artificial intelligence to help users improve, maintain, or rehabilitate motor skills more efficiently. The materials mention that prototypes exist for its CueMate™ product line, but do not state whether it has been commercially launched.

Core Capabilities

Its core AI capability comes from decoding and analyzing human movement measurement data. iCueMotion says its proprietary models can extract information about user performance and the process of skill acquisition, and generate learning-enhancement algorithms such as real-time feedback and training instructions based on an understanding of how the brain organizes, learns, and executes complex movements. CueMate focuses on four layers: understanding the user’s current skill level, diagnosing the next improvement point, guiding what to focus on during on-field training, and instantly determining whether a movement is correct.

Pricing and Integration

The publicly available materials do not provide pricing, a free trial, purchase links, or details on the business model. They also do not include API, SDK, or developer documentation. What can be confirmed is that the platform is envisioned for deployment in wearables, embedded sensors, sports equipment, and medical devices, using sensors, embedded computing, and AI to deliver more actionable training and rehabilitation insights.

Pros and Cons

Its strength lies in a clear direction: moving from “recording movement” to “enhancing learning,” with an emphasis on individual traits, body type, skill level, and health condition. It also has a foundation of 10 years of R&D, design, and testing, along with multiple granted and pending patents. The limitations are also obvious: there are no public case studies, quantified results, supported-sport coverage, privacy/compliance details, or service/support information. At this stage, it looks more like a technology platform or lab introduction than a mature SaaS product page.

Who It’s For and Access from China

It is better suited to sports-tech companies, wearable hardware teams, professional training organizations, rehabilitation equipment companies, and medical or sports scenarios exploring movement AI, rather than ordinary consumers looking for an app they can start using immediately. Access from China, payment methods, and Chinese-language support are not disclosed and should be treated as “unknown.” If deployed in China, it would typically need to be evaluated for replacement and integration together with local sensor hardware, sports rehabilitation platforms, or athletic training systems.
